## Step 4: Enable the Retention Sweeper

Okay, this is the fun part. The new sweeper (codename Dustpan) replaces the old nightly purge script. It deletes expired records in small batches so it won't hammer the primary like the old one did. Run it in dry-run mode first and eyeball the candidate counts — if they look sane (under ~50k per table), flip it to live mode. Dry-run mode should be started with the following configuration values.

service settings:
[casax]
port = 6379
team = rusir
host = casax.zemvarhq.corp
region = outer-4
access_code = ac_9808ce
timeout_ms = 1500

# Gateway rate limiting config for the Fernhollow internal API gateway.
# Limits are per-tenant: 200 req/min default, burst of 50.
# Reviewer note: the limiter reads its state from the shared cache,
# and auth to that cache is required at boot.
# The cache auth secret goes on the next line.

vault entry, yahif-yajep: COURIER_KEY29=b802bdf8034096b65a51c6ba5abe2

Subject: Export retry cut-over — done

Team, the cut-over of the Ferrowick export pipeline to the new retry scheduler finished last night without data loss. Failed exports now re-enter the queue with exponential backoff instead of the old fixed five-minute loop, and poison messages are shunted to a dead-letter store after the cap is hit. We replayed all 212 stuck exports from the backlog successfully. For future maintainers debugging retry behavior, the scheduler settings we went live with are reproduced below.

service settings:
novath:
  pin: 1396
  tenant: pelys
  seal: seal_ccc035e1
  metrics_host: metrics.novath.qorvelworks.test
  standby_team: fraeth
  escalation: drueth-zorok
  nonce: 61d508